It’s Dark in Here – Shel Silverstein

I am writing these poems From inside a lion,

And it’s rather dark in here.

So please excuse the handwriting

Which may not be too clear.

But this afternoon by the lion’s cage I’m afraid I got too near.

And I’m writing these lines From inside a lion,

And it’s rather dark in here. ~ It’s Dark in Here
